

Getting to know
ANDREW GE
SAG-AFTRA, AEA
An avid live performer and musician, Ge (pronounced "guh") made his theatre stage debut in the 2019 production of "Mamma Mia!" at East West Players. Since then, he has worked on regional stage productions ranging from dramatic pieces such as Lloyd Suh's Pullitzer-nominated play "The Far Country" at Berkeley Repertory Theatre to the comedic musical "A Christmas Story" at Centre Theatre Group's Ahmanson Theatre. On-camera, Ge has played a wide range of roles in independent films and is looking to make his network debut. Currently, Ge can be seen playing "Xander" in the short film "Lawyered Up" which premiered at the 2025 Newport Beach Film Festival, as well as “Henry” in Wong Fu’s “Blue Suit” on YouTube. He can be heard dubbing several Netflix shows, most notably for the player “Orbit” in Season 1 of Netflix’s “Devil’s Plan”. In his free time, he enjoys photography, mahjong, and matcha.
Ge is managed by Rothman/Andrés Entertainment.
